As AI becomes more common, many people wonder if it can take the place of a therapist. While AI doesn’t have the human connection and emotional insight needed for real healing, it can still be a helpful tool in your therapy process. Think about using AI to summarize your journal entries, identify negative thought patterns, or create personalized self-care plans. These tools can improve your therapy experience, helping you reflect and stay engaged with your healing.
